Output 61813a6cd781dfa968142dc25d6dc65f8bceec1fe2de863bdd58bbc2fe4b74bf:1

value
1605710
script pubkey
OP_0 OP_PUSHBYTES_20 8ec6d8f6f43452151d400169ed72897a7cb57cfb
address
bc1q3mrd3ah5x3fp282qq9576u5f0f7t2l8m2x46fn
transaction
61813a6cd781dfa968142dc25d6dc65f8bceec1fe2de863bdd58bbc2fe4b74bf
confirmations
37606
spent
true